Finding Baseball Games on DirecTV: A Comprehensive Guide

First off, the channels that typically broadcast Major League Baseball (MLB) games on DirecTV include ESPN, ESPN2, Fox, FS1 (Fox Sports 1), TBS, and MLB Network. However, it's not always as simple as tuning into one of these channels and hoping for the best. The exact channel for a specific game depends on several factors, such as the day of the week, the teams playing, and any broadcasting agreements in place. For instance, ESPN often airs its "Sunday Night Baseball" games, while Fox usually has the Saturday afternoon game. FS1 might carry a weeknight game, and TBS often picks up games later in the season as part of its playoff coverage. Meanwhile, MLB Network can be a treasure trove of games, highlights, and baseball analysis.

To pinpoint the exact channel, your best bet is to consult the DirecTV programming guide. You can access this guide directly on your TV through your DirecTV receiver or via the DirecTV app on your smartphone or tablet. Simply navigate to the sports section or use the search function to look for "baseball." The guide will show you a detailed listing of all upcoming games, along with their corresponding channels. Another excellent resource is the MLB's official website, which provides a comprehensive schedule of all games and their broadcast channels. Sites like ESPN.com also offer similar information. These resources are updated regularly, ensuring you have the most accurate information at your fingertips. Using the DirecTV Programming Guide

The DirecTV programming guide is your best friend when it comes to finding baseball games. This guide is super easy to use and can save you a lot of time and frustration. You can access it directly on your TV through your DirecTV receiver. Just hit the "Guide" button on your remote, and you'll see a grid of channels and showtimes. From there, you can navigate to the sports section or use the search function to look for "baseball." The guide will show you a detailed listing of all upcoming games, along with their corresponding channels and times. It's a straightforward way to see what's playing and when.

Alternatively, you can use the DirecTV app on your smartphone or tablet. The app mirrors the functionality of the on-screen guide and allows you to browse listings, set reminders, and even record games remotely. This is especially handy if you're not at home but want to make sure you don't miss a game. The DirecTV website also offers a programming guide that you can access from any computer. All these options provide you with the same comprehensive information, so you can choose the method that's most convenient for you. Tips for Optimizing Your Baseball Viewing Experience

To really get the most out of your baseball viewing experience on DirecTV, there are a few things you can do to optimize it. First, make sure you have the right DirecTV package. Some sports channels, like MLB Network, might require a specific add-on or higher-tier package. So, check your current plan and see if you need to upgrade to get access to all the games you want to watch. Second, take advantage of DirecTV's DVR features. Set up recordings for games you can't watch live, so you can catch up later at your convenience. This is especially useful during the busy baseball season when multiple games might be on at the same time.

Third, use the DirecTV app to set reminders for upcoming games. The app will send you notifications so you never miss a game. Fourth, consider investing in a sports subscription service like MLB.TV. This can supplement your DirecTV coverage and give you access to even more games, including out-of-market matchups. Fifth, make sure your TV and audio settings are optimized for sports viewing. Adjust the picture settings for clarity and motion, and consider using a soundbar or surround sound system for a more immersive experience. Troubleshooting Common Issues

Even with the best setup, you might run into a few issues when trying to watch baseball games on DirecTV. One common problem is missing channels. If you're not seeing a channel that's supposed to be part of your package, double-check your subscription details. Sometimes, channels get accidentally removed or require a separate subscription. You can contact DirecTV customer service to sort this out. Another issue is signal problems. If you're experiencing pixelation or buffering, check your satellite dish for any obstructions like trees or snow. Make sure all the cables are securely connected. You can also try resetting your DirecTV receiver by unplugging it for a few minutes and then plugging it back in.

Sometimes, the programming guide might not be accurate. If you see discrepancies between the guide and the actual broadcast, try refreshing the guide or checking online sources like MLB.com or ESPN.com for the correct listings. If you're using the DirecTV app, make sure it's updated to the latest version. Outdated apps can sometimes cause problems with channel listings and streaming. Lastly, if you're still having trouble, don't hesitate to contact DirecTV customer support. They can provide personalized assistance and troubleshoot any technical issues you might be experiencing.
